Foros del Web » Creando para Internet » Flash y Actionscript »

Cargar imágenes externas para transición

Estas en el tema de Cargar imágenes externas para transición en el foro de Flash y Actionscript en Foros del Web. Hola compañeros, saludos, creo que tengo un problema muy común, pero no he podido resolverlo. Cuál es la manera óptima de realizar una transición de ...
  #1 (permalink)  
Antiguo 10/02/2010, 16:03
Avatar de ISW
ISW
 
Fecha de Ingreso: noviembre-2008
Mensajes: 110
Antigüedad: 16 años
Puntos: 3
Mensaje Cargar imágenes externas para transición

Hola compañeros, saludos, creo que tengo un problema muy común, pero no he podido resolverlo.

Cuál es la manera óptima de realizar una transición de imágenes .jpg en AS2, que se estén ciclando automáticamente, mandándolas llamar desde una carpeta externa?

El problema es que no quiero meterlas dentro del swf porque pesaría bastante. Lo que estoy haciendo es meter un mc vacío con un contenedor, dentro de ese contenedor, cada 10 frames estoy mandando llamar una foto de 450 x 450 px desde una carpeta externa, con loadMovie. Funciona bien localmente, pero en el servidor (por la velocidad de internet) algunas fotos no se visualizan lo suficiente porque la línea de tiempo continua avanzando, mandando llamar otra foto cada 10 frames. Cómo puedo solucionar esto? Imagino que cargando antes las 10 fotos, pero no se hacer esto. Espero alguien tenga la solución y pueda ayudarme. Muchas gracias por todo.
  #2 (permalink)  
Antiguo 10/02/2010, 17:40
Avatar de Bandit
Moderador
 
Fecha de Ingreso: julio-2003
Ubicación: Lima - Perú
Mensajes: 16.726
Antigüedad: 21 años, 4 meses
Puntos: 406
Respuesta: Cargar imágenes externas para transición

Hola ISW:
Visita mi página, allí tienes un tutorial que se llama: Galería imágenes.

Espero que te sea de utilidad.
__________________
Bandit.
Si no sabes estudia y si sabes enseña.
http://www.banditwebdesign.com/
  #3 (permalink)  
Antiguo 10/02/2010, 22:03
Avatar de ISW
ISW
 
Fecha de Ingreso: noviembre-2008
Mensajes: 110
Antigüedad: 16 años
Puntos: 3
Respuesta: Cargar imágenes externas para transición

Muchas gracias Bandit, funciona muy bien el tutorial y es justo lo que yo preguntaba, pero surgieron nuevas dudas, al analizar el tutorial, ya que éste va dentro de otro swf principal.

Los hechos: tengo un swf principal que manda llamar al mc de las transiciones. El swf principal mide 800x600. El swf de las transiciones mide 470 x 470 px, ya que cada foto mide 450x450px, con lo cual le queda un marco blanco de 10x10.

> Cómo puedo incorporarle un marco, al cual le podría dar sombra o convertirlo en mc? La programación no permite que meta otras capas u objetos, ya que no funciona adecuadamente incorporando más objetos.
> Cómo hacer que la película que mando llamar desde el swf principal aparezca en determinada posición X/Y del escenario, si tomáramos en cuenta que no iría centrado el swf de la transición de las fotos? Cuando lo manda llamar aparece pegado a la izquierda y arriba, que es la posición 0,0.
> En que parte del código le modifico para que avance un poco más rápido la transición?


Muchas gracias Bandit, por tomarte el tiempo en responder, se que tienes muchas dudas más que resolver, incluso dudas tuyas; espero cuando tengas libre me puedas orientar, muchas gracias compañero. PD: bonitas modelos en los tutoriales ;)
  #4 (permalink)  
Antiguo 11/02/2010, 12:01
Avatar de Bandit
Moderador
 
Fecha de Ingreso: julio-2003
Ubicación: Lima - Perú
Mensajes: 16.726
Antigüedad: 21 años, 4 meses
Puntos: 406
Respuesta: Cargar imágenes externas para transición

Simplemente crea un MC_vacío y lo pones en el vértice superior izquierdo del marco que haz hecho y le pones como nombre de instancia: contenedor y allí cargas la película que contiene la transición de imágenes.

Espero haberte sido de ayuda.
__________________
Bandit.
Si no sabes estudia y si sabes enseña.
http://www.banditwebdesign.com/
  #5 (permalink)  
Antiguo 19/02/2010, 00:42
Avatar de ISW
ISW
 
Fecha de Ingreso: noviembre-2008
Mensajes: 110
Antigüedad: 16 años
Puntos: 3
Respuesta: Cargar imágenes externas para transición

Saludos Bandit, te comunico que no me funcionó la solución.

Primero creo un mc vacío, luego, lo ubico dentro del escenario el cual mide 470*470 px en la ubicación X=10 y Y=10 con nombre de instancia contenedor. Después el código de AS contenido en una capa en la línea principal (que me proporcionaste de tu web, del tutorial llamado Galería imágenes) lo corto tal y cual y lo pego dentro del mc vacío, y no me funciona; lo pego en la línea principal en la instancia contenedor de mc vacío y tampoco funciona.

No sé donde esté el mal, imagino que es porque el código ya no se encuentra en la línea principal. Espero puedas ayudarme nuevamente.

También me gustaría saber que línea modificar en el código para acelerar un poco más la transición de imágenes. De antemano muchas gracias Bandit; espero alguien más también sepa la respuesta, para salir de dudas. Gracias
  #6 (permalink)  
Antiguo 19/02/2010, 09:55
Avatar de Bandit
Moderador
 
Fecha de Ingreso: julio-2003
Ubicación: Lima - Perú
Mensajes: 16.726
Antigüedad: 21 años, 4 meses
Puntos: 406
Respuesta: Cargar imágenes externas para transición

Tienes 2 opciones:
1.- Cargarlo por niveles.
2.- Colocar en el primer frame de la película que contiene la galerís el siguiente código: this._lockroot = true;

Espero haberte sido de ayuda.
__________________
Bandit.
Si no sabes estudia y si sabes enseña.
http://www.banditwebdesign.com/
  #7 (permalink)  
Antiguo 20/02/2010, 19:15
Avatar de ISW
ISW
 
Fecha de Ingreso: noviembre-2008
Mensajes: 110
Antigüedad: 16 años
Puntos: 3
Respuesta: Cargar imágenes externas para transición

Saludos Bandit. Te comento que hasta ahora no he podido encontrar la solución. Ya estuve tratando con niveles desde antes, pero ese no es el problema, tengo los niveles bajo control. También hice lo que me dijiste en el swf de this._lockroot = true; y lo estuve investigando, pero tampoco se solucionó. Imagino que el problema está en el código y al momento de mandarlo llamar desde otro swf, al tratar de meterlo en un mc, para poder darle sombra y otras características a las fotos.

No hay manera de compartir archivos para ver si le puedes hechar un ojo cuando tengas tiempo?

Ya intenté de todo, lo malo que estoy detenido en un proyecto que me urge y no logro encontrar la solución, por eso acudo a tí compañero. Espero puedas ayudarme. Gracias.

Última edición por ISW; 21/02/2010 a las 16:59
  #8 (permalink)  
Antiguo 21/02/2010, 12:45
Avatar de Bandit
Moderador
 
Fecha de Ingreso: julio-2003
Ubicación: Lima - Perú
Mensajes: 16.726
Antigüedad: 21 años, 4 meses
Puntos: 406
Respuesta: Cargar imágenes externas para transición

Sube tus archivos a: http://www.megaupload.com/

Espero poderte ser de ayuda.
__________________
Bandit.
Si no sabes estudia y si sabes enseña.
http://www.banditwebdesign.com/
  #9 (permalink)  
Antiguo 21/02/2010, 18:27
Avatar de ISW
ISW
 
Fecha de Ingreso: noviembre-2008
Mensajes: 110
Antigüedad: 16 años
Puntos: 3
Respuesta: Cargar imágenes externas para transición

Bandit, no sabes cuanto te lo agradezco. Aquí tienes el link de mis archivos en Megaupload:

http://www.megaupload.com/?d=HCPNINVF

Te agradezco tu gran ayuda compañero, espero haber resumido y explicarme perfectamente, sino aquí ando, reviso este tema todos los días en busca de nuevas respuestas. Gracias.

La película de la transición de fotos mide 450*450px, así como cada fotografía que aparece mide lo mismo, no logro ubicar cada fotografía en el centro y ampliar a 470x470 para dejar una capa aparte y sea el marco, que sería blanco de 10px.

La película fotos.swf es mandada llamar desde main.swf (800*600px), con loadMovie, pero no logro meter fotos.swf dentro de un MC para poder mandarlo llamar de manera más práctica y a su vez aplicarle sombra y ubicarlo en cierta parte del escenario en X/Y. Espero haberme explicado.

Nuevamente muchas gracias por tu gran ayuda.
  #10 (permalink)  
Antiguo 23/02/2010, 12:23
Avatar de Bandit
Moderador
 
Fecha de Ingreso: julio-2003
Ubicación: Lima - Perú
Mensajes: 16.726
Antigüedad: 21 años, 4 meses
Puntos: 406
Respuesta: Cargar imágenes externas para transición

Hola ISW:
Lo que tienes que hacer es crear otra capa y colocar el punto de registro del MC: box_bg en el vértice superior izquierdo del marco que hay allí y le pones como nombre de instancia contenedor.
Y el código de la Capa de acciones éste código:
Código:
contenedors.loadMovie("fotos.swf");
Espero haberte sido de ayuda.
__________________
Bandit.
Si no sabes estudia y si sabes enseña.
http://www.banditwebdesign.com/
  #11 (permalink)  
Antiguo 24/02/2010, 23:47
Avatar de ISW
ISW
 
Fecha de Ingreso: noviembre-2008
Mensajes: 110
Antigüedad: 16 años
Puntos: 3
Respuesta: Cargar imágenes externas para transición

Listo Bandit, ya solucione el problema con los consejos que me diste y unas cosas extras que faltaban que seguí investigando.

No lo solucione como quería, no logré obtener los resultados que quería, o al menos no de la forma en que esperaba pero ya quedó solucionado. Muchas gracias.

La cosa está en que en el archivo donde está el código de las fotos (fotos.swf) que me pasaste, ahí mismo quería hacer el marco de 10*10px y poder aplicarle un filtro (drop shadow), así, solo mando llamar el mc localmente donde estaría la transición de las fotos. Y por último, el archivo principal, main.swf solo mandaría llamar a fotos.swf, ya con su marco y su filtro desde su origen. No se si me explique.

Muchas gracias. Hay alguna manera de pasarte Karma?? No se como hacerlo, creo que eso es más adelante ya que yo consiga un poco creo (a juzgar por lo que leí). De cualquier manera te agradezco muchísimo tu gran ayuda Bandit. Estamos en contacto.

A cualquiera que ocupe ayuda en este tema con gusto se la brindaré. Saludos.


Etiquetas: externas
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 22:35.